    Chapters
    0:00 - Unreal Engine 5
    0:14 - Planning and Brainstorming
    1:12 - Creating the Environment
    1:59 - Omniverse Multi-App
    2:47 - Previs Animation Blocking
    4:00 - 3D Cameras + Customizing Mocap
    4:59 - Completed Previs Pass
    5:27 - Moving from LA to NYC
    6:39 - Xsens Motion Capture
    7:31 - Acting and Choreography
    8:46 - Processing, Editing, Cleaning Up Animation Data
    9:38 - Custom Animation Retiming
    10:37 - Animation Retargeting
    12:40 - Niagara FX and Props
    13:01 - Cameras and Rendering
    13:40 - Sound Design and Caveats
    14:10 - Final Animation (For Now)

  • @liampugh
    @liampugh 28 дней назад

    You can edit the shots together in unreal using a master sequence, so you don't have to spend all that time rendering coverage. Just render out the finished edit when you're done.

    • @SirWade
      @SirWade  28 дней назад

      Very true! We were originally going to do some other stuff outside of UE (that we didn’t do) so a master sequence would have been way smarter in the end lol

  • @RandallsDiversion
    @RandallsDiversion Месяц назад

    Hi does the prop tracker works without placing on hand? If you throw the weapon, will it be tracked?

    • @SirWade
      @SirWade  Месяц назад +2

      Sort of, it’s separate from the hand tracker so technically yes- but the cable isn’t very long because it’s still connected to the body, so you can’t really throw it. But I did let go / pick up the prop a few times and that works
